Study Notes

  • Coaxial cable is used to connect computers to a network.
  • There are several types of coaxial cable with different maximum lengths and quality.
  • Fiber optic cable is not affected by EMI or RFI and has two types: multimode and single-mode.
  • TCP/IP is a set of standard rules for communication between computers.
  • Other internet protocols include SMTP, PPP, FTP, SFTP, HTTP, HTTPS, TELNET, POP3, IPv4, IPv6, ICMP, and UDP.
  • IPv6 is the latest version of the Internet Protocol and offers enhanced security features.
  • ICMP is used to send error messages and operational information about network conditions.
  • UDP is a connectionless, unreliable transport layer protocol used for real-time applications.
  • Each protocol serves a different purpose in communication and networking.
  • Understanding these protocols is important for effective network management and troubleshooting.
